What Is False Imprisonment?

False imprisonment involves wrongly holding someone against their will. False imprisonment is an intentional tort, like assault and battery. If someone holds you against your will, you can file a personal injury lawsuit against them for damages. There are defenses to false imprisonment claims, including consent, suspected theft, and self-defense.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Personal Injury Lawyer To Sue for False Imprisonment?

It is challenging to prove damages in a false imprisonment case. You should consider talking with a personal injury lawyer about your options if you find yourself in situations similar to:

  • Store security detained you for an unreasonable amount of time
  • Someone locked you in a car or a room and refused to let you leave, whether in a business or a home
  • Someone threatened you with physical harm to prevent you from leaving
  • You were drugged or sedated against your will to keep you somewhere
  • A police officer detained you without probable cause

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Personal Injury Lawyer?

If you don’t hire a personal injury lawyer, you might struggle to get fair compensation for your injuries. Without legal guidance, you could miss important deadlines to file a lawsuit, fail to gather the right evidence, or be taken advantage of by insurance companies. This might result in accepting a settlement offer that is less than what you need to cover medical bills, lost wages, and other expenses. A lawyer helps protect your rights, builds a strong case, and negotiates on your behalf, increasing your chances of getting the most possible compensation.
